  • In order to estimate release water from reservoirs located on ungaged watersheds, an algorithm was suggested based on hydrologic reservoir routing and real time calibrating watershed parameters. A prototype - simple computer program was developed to implement the algorithm with Genetic Algorithm technic. The program was applied to a mid-size reservoir and its ungauged watershed area using observed rainfall data, spillway gates operation data and reservoir water stage time series data under a existing storm event. The result shows that the algorithm and the prototype would be useful to simulate released water from reservoirs.

  • In this study, in order to establish the criteria for evaluation of importance by the type of facility specialized for agricultural reservoirs, an expert group consisting of a total of 167 members who were in management, or specialized in the fields of design, research, and diagnosis were organized, and the importance for facilities was set with application of the AHP technique. The importance of dam body, spillway, and intake structure composing a reservoir were set at 59%, 24%, and 17%, and the importance of dam crest, upstream slope, and downstream slope constituting a dam body was set at 32%, 31%, and 37%, respectively. In addition, the importance of approach channel, regulated channel, chute channel, and stilling basin consisting a spillway was set at 15%, 44%, 26%, and 15%, and the importance of inclined conduit and outlet conduit consisting an intake structure was set at 35% and 65%, respectively. The safety grade of the reservoirs evaluated by applying the newly presented importance values in this study showed the rearrangement of the grades with a change of 11% compared to the previous grades. In this way, the newly established criteria are expected to be utilized as basic data with strategic importance in reservoir safety management and disaster prevention as well as the operation of systems in the future.

  • As the frequency of drought increases due to climate change, water scarcity in agriculture would be a main issue. However, it seems difficult to solve the water scarcity by securing alternative water sources. The aim of this study is to analyze optimal water supply capacity of agricultural reservoir for emergency operation connecting reservoirs and dams. First, we simulated the water storage of agricultural reservoir playing the role emergency water supplier to other water facility such as dams and other reservoirs. In particular, the results of simulation of water storage through K-HAS model was calibrated using the optimization process based on ratio correction factors of outflow and inflow. Finally, the optimal amount of water supply securing water supply reliability in emergency interconnection operation was analyzed. The results of this study showed that Janchi reservoir could supply 12.8 thousand m3/day maintaining 90 % water supply reliability. The result of this study could suggest the standard for connecting water facilities as emergency water supply.

  • This study has performed comparative analysis on characteristics of reservoirs in their use through correlation analysis on seasonal variation of water quality factors in agricultural reservoirs and multipurpose dams. Agricultural reservoirs show the high relationship between Chl-a and other water quality factors while the correlation among COD, BOD, and SS is strong in multipurpose dams. Agricultural reservoirs have the high relationship between various water quality factors in season such as Chl-a and pH ($R^{2}=0.294$) in Spring, pH and water temperature ($R^{2}=0.246$) in Summer, and Chl-a and BOD ($R^{2}=0.435$) in Fall, and between COD and BOD ($R^{2}=0.370$) in Winter, respectively, for Sapgyo reservoir while Chl-a and T-P ($R^{2}=0.739$) in Spring, T-P and SS ($R^{2}=0.876$) in Summer, and Chl-a and SS ($R^{2}=0.600$) in Fall, and between COD and SS ($R^{2}=0.998$) in Winter, respectively, for Seokmun reservoir. Boryeong dam has the strong relationship between T-P and SS ($R^{2}=0.511$) in Spring while the relation between COD and SS is high in other seasons with the values of $R^{2}$ of 0.362, 0.665, and 0.500 in Summer, Fall, and winter, respectively. The first and second water quality factors in relationship are COD and BOD in Sapgyo and Seokmun reservoirs, which is similar to the characteristics in Winter for multipurpose dams. Chl-a has no relationship with other water quality factors in Boryeong dam in operation for both flood control and low water regulation purposes. The result of this research is expected to provide contributions to the seasonal water quality control and analysis on characteristics for each reservoir by monitoring.

  • For the system benefit optimization by considering risk or reliability from a multiple reservoir system using the Monte Carlo technique, many stochastically generated inflow series have to be used for the system analysis. In this study, the stochastically generated inflow series for the multiple reservoir system operation are preprocessed according to the considered system objectives and operating time periods. Through this procedure, several representative inflow series which have discrete probability levels and operation horizons are selected among the thousands of generated inflows. Then a deterministic optimization technique is applied to the power energy estimation from the Han River Reservoirs System which considers five reservoirs in the study. It took much lower computational requirements then using the original Monte Carlo Technique, even though estimated result was almost similar.

  • This study refers to the development of a hydrologic model simulating daily inflow and release rates for inigation reservoirs. A daily - based model is needed for adequate operation of an irrigation reservoir sufficing the water demand for paddy fields which is closely related to meteorological conditions. And the objective of this study is to develop a reservoir release rate model and then to calibrata the parameters. The release rates model considers daily water demands , water supply for transplanting, minmum release for maintaining canal flow, and maxirnun and regular flooding depth for determining effective rainfall on paddy fields. Each of the factors in the model was regarded as a lumped pararuter representing the average condition of a whole irrigated area. The water demand was estimated form the potential evapotranspiration by Penman method, the effective rainfall, and the infiltration on paddy fields. The release model was found to be capable of adequately simulating daily reservoir releases based on meteorological data.

  • This study refers to the development of a hydrologic model simulating daily inflow and release rates for irrigation reservoirs. A daily - based model is needed for adequate operation of an irrigation reservoir sufficing the water demand for paddy fields which is closely related to meteorological conditions. Inflow rates to a reservoir need to be accurately described, which may be simulated using a hydrologic model from daily rainfall data. And the objective of this paper is to develop, test, and apply a hydrologic model for daily runoff simmulation. A well - known tank model was selected and modified to simulate daily inflow rates. The model parameters were calibrated using observed runoff data from twelve watersheds, Relationships between the parameters and the watershed characteristics were derived by a multiple regression analysis. The simulation results were in agreement with the data. The inflow model was found to simulate low flow conditions more accurately than high flow conditions, which may be adequate for water resources utilization.

  • The south-western part of Korea is situated in an unbalance of water supply and demand relating to the Keum, Mankyung, Dongjin and Youngsan River and their estuary reservoirs. For example, the Keum River estuary reservoir is discharging the larger amount of yearly runoff into the sea due to the small storage capacity, while Saemankeum estuary reservoir which is under construction, has the smaller runoff comparing with its strorage capacity. And the downstream area of the Youngsan River, such as Youngkwang, Youngam are deficient in water due to larger demand and smaller supply. In order to solve the above unbalanced water supply and demand and also to improve the water use effciency, the Hierarchical Operation Model for Multi-reservoir System(HOMMS) has been developed and applied to analyze the multi-reservoir operation assuming that the above reservoirs were linked each other. The result of this study shows that $2,148{\times}106\;\textrm{m}^3$ of annual additional water requirement for agricultural and rural water demands are required in this region at 2011 of target year, and these demands can be resolved by diverting and reusing $1,913{\times}106\;\textrm{m}^3$ of the released water from the estuary reservoirs into the sea.
